Andertons Music Co., based in Guildford, is seeking a part-time Treasury Assistant to join their finance team. This role involves handling day-to-day treasury functions such as cashing up, bank reconciliations, and supporting departmental duties.
Applicants should have office experience in treasury or accounts and be proficient in Microsoft Excel. The position offers flexible working patterns while maintaining 20-25 hours a week. The closing date for applications is 15th May 2026.
